This will be a leisurely country walk of less than 5 miles starting and finishing in Rye. The route is pan flat and we will pause for a picnic lunch half-way at Camber castle - bring your own sandwiches and drink. If the weather is inclement we can retreat to the nearby bird observation hide near the castle.
At the end of the walk we can stop for tea or at a pub for refreshments.
We start and finish at Rye station leaving at 11am. Trains run hourly between Eastbourne and Ashford International with arrivals from both Eastbourne and Ashford due at 10:48. There is a car park for those who need to drive and a Google map centred on the station below.
Rye is on the line from Ashford International to Eastbourne. During the day the a train runs hourly in each directions with the trains conveniently crossing at Rye. This means arrivals and departures from/to Ashford International and Eastbourne are all at 48 minutes past the hour.
